First Solar Q3 Earnings: Misses Revenue Expectations but Surpasses EPS Forecast Amid Strong Gross Margins and Backlog.

First Solar, a U.S.-based manufacturer of cadmium telluride thin-film solar modules, has reported Q3 2023 earnings, missing on revenues but exceeding expectations on earnings per share. The company delivered $801 million in revenues, falling short of expectations of $892 million. However, it reported an earnings per quarter of $2.50, exceeding expectations by 22.5%. The company also delivered gross margins significantly higher than Wall Street expectations, largely due to lower sales freight costs, higher module average sales prices, and a higher volume of U.K.-produced modules. The firm’s backlog of orders has reached 82 GW and year-to-date orders have accumulated to 28 GW. First Solar is also producing bifacial thin-fil modules, a first for the industry, which the company claims is a breakthrough in the industry.
